Golden Retrievers were first developed in Scotland during the mid-19th century. The breed was created by a man named Lord Tweedmouth, who aimed to create a dog that could retrieve game from both land and water. He crossed a yellow retriever with a water spaniel to create the breed that we know and love today.

Golden Retrievers soon became popular in other parts of the world, including the United States, where they were recognized by the American Kennel Club in 1925. The breed quickly gained a reputation for their friendly and outgoing personalities, as well as their intelligence and trainability.

Today, Golden Retrievers are one of the most popular dog breeds in the world and are beloved for their loyalty, affectionate nature, and ability to get along with both children and other animals. They continue to be used as working dogs, including in search and rescue missions, and as therapy dogs due to their gentle nature. Golden Retrievers have truly earned their place as one of the most beloved and iconic dog breeds of all time.
